From the employer
KRXI/KAME is looking for an Multi-Media Journalist. Your responsibilities as an MMJ will include reporting, shooting and editing news stories, enterprising story ideas, developing contacts, as well as other responsibilities as assigned. You will be expected to produce daily content on a variety of platforms including the internet, social networking sites and mobile phones, in addition to television.
Skills and Experience:
- Sharp news judgment
- The ability to tell an NPPA style story
- Excellent technical skills
- The ability to work well independently
- Must have and maintain a valid license and a good driving record
Requirements and Qualifications:
- At least 1-2 years of experience in journalism, broadcasting, or multimedia storytelling, including internships, freelance work, or collegiate media experience.
- Experience with live shots is required
- Experience with Live-U is a plus
While applying online, please include a link to your online demo reel
